Audio Streaming

Audio streaming is a technology that enables the real-time or on-demand transmission of audio content over the internet without requiring users to download files. It works by sending audio data in a continuous flow, allowing playback to start while the rest of the data is still being transmitted. This is widely used for music services, podcasts, live broadcasts, and voice communication applications.

🧊Why learn Audio Streaming?

Developers should learn audio streaming to build applications like music platforms (e.g., Spotify), podcast apps, live radio services, or real-time voice chat systems. It's essential for handling large-scale audio delivery with low latency, supporting features such as adaptive bitrate streaming for varying network conditions, and integrating with cloud-based audio processing services.
